摘要: web.xml文件是用来初始化配置信息:比如welcome页面、servlet、servlet-mapping、filter、listener、启动加载级别等。当你的web工程没用到这些时,你可以不用web.xml文件来配置你的Application。每个xml文件都有定义它书写规则的Schema文件,也就是说javaEE的定义web.xml所对应的xml Schema文件中定义了多少种标签元素,web.xml中就可以出现它所定义的标签元素,也就具备哪些特定的功能。web.xml的模式文件是由Sun 公司定义的,每个web.xml文件的根元素为中,必须标明这个web.xml使用的是哪个模式文件 阅读全文
posted @ 2014-02-15 13:55 左手心_疼 阅读(390) 评论(0) 推荐(0) 编辑
摘要: web。xml 中JSP配置、servlet配置及 EL表达式【摘要】servlet 基本配置1 2 LoginServlet3 com.dy.java.servlet.LoginServlet4 5 6 7 LoginServlet8 /LoginServlet9 JSP 配置 configuration configuration.jsp configurationt /configuration 标签作用: web.xml中的标签支持对JSP的批量配置包括和【 taglib 】 n。标签库;标签】其中元素在JSP 1.2... 阅读全文
posted @ 2014-02-15 13:44 左手心_疼 阅读(19853) 评论(0) 推荐(0) 编辑
摘要: 【摘要】 隐藏对象用在jsp表达式和脚本中,不能直接用在jsp声明中,因为这些隐藏对象是容器在jspservice方法中定义的,在这个方法中定义的变量不能在jsp声明中使用。可以通过参数方法将隐藏对象传递到jsp声明自定义的方法中,而且自定义的方法必须要抛异常。域范围从小到大: pageContext request session application代表 HttpServletResponse 的: response代表 ServletConfig 的: config代表 JspWriter 的: out代表当前 jsp 页面生成的 Servlet 的实例的: page (Object. 阅读全文
posted @ 2014-02-15 12:53 左手心_疼 阅读(2057) 评论(0) 推荐(1) 编辑
摘要: 第四章 JSP语法—转—Rollen Holt - 博客园http://www.cnblogs.com/rollenholt/archive/2011/07/04/2097376.html#FeedBack[本章导读]有了前面的基础后,本章开始学习JSP语法。JSP页面主要由JSP元素和HTML代码构成,其中JSP代码完成相应的动态功能。JSP基础语法包括注释、指令、脚本以及动作元素,此外,JSP还提供了一些由容器实现和管理的内置对象。本章完整介绍了JSP的基本语法,并以实例加深理解。4.1 JSP语法概述在JSP页面中,可分为JSP程序代码和其他程序代码两部分。JSP程序代码全部写在之间,其 阅读全文
posted @ 2014-02-14 20:09 左手心_疼 阅读(718) 评论(0) 推荐(0) 编辑
摘要: 1.JSP 简介JSP(Java Server Pages)是由Sun Microsystems公司倡导、许多公司参与一起建立的一种动态网页技术标准。JSP技术有点类似ASP技术,它是在传统的网页HTML文件(*.htm,*.html)中插入Java程序段(Scriptlet)和JSP标记(tag),从而形成JSP文件,后缀名为(*.jsp)。 用JSP开发的Web应用是跨平台的,既能在Linux下运行,也能在其他操作系统上运行。2.JSP 工作原理JSP页面工作原理图当一个JSP文件第一次被请求的时候,JSP引擎(本身也是一个Servlet)首先会把这个JSP文件转换成一个Java源文件。在 阅读全文
posted @ 2014-02-14 16:23 左手心_疼 阅读(22967) 评论(0) 推荐(0) 编辑
摘要: 1 /* & :地址运算符 :& 给出变量的地址。 2 // * :间接运算符(取值运算符):* 用来获取变量中存放的数值。*/ 3 ptr =&x;//把变量 x 的 地址赋给ptr 4 //ptr指向 X 变量 X 放 数据 5 y= *ptr;//得到 ptr指向的值 6 //-----------------------// 7 //ptr =&x; //--------------// 8 // y= *ptr; //-------------// 9 //------------------------//10 //推出 y=x;//-------- 阅读全文
posted @ 2011-06-15 23:19 左手心_疼 阅读(295) 评论(0) 推荐(0) 编辑
摘要: 该函数声明在stdio.h头文件中,使用的时候要包含stdio.h头文件getchar有一个int型的返回值.当程序调用getchar时.程序就等着用户按键.用户输入的字符被存放在键盘缓冲区中.直到用户按回车为止(回车字符也放在缓冲区中).当用户键入回车之后,getchar才开始从stdin流中每次读入一个字符.getchar函数的返回值是用户输入的第一个字符的ASCII码,如出错返回-1,且将用户输入的字符回显到屏幕.如用户在按回车之前输入了不止一个字符,其他字符会保留在键盘缓存区中,等待后续getchar调用读取.也就是说,后续的getchar调用不会等待用户按键,而直接读取缓冲区中的字符 阅读全文
posted @ 2011-06-14 23:30 左手心_疼 阅读(305) 评论(0) 推荐(1) 编辑
摘要: 对动态单向链表进行建立、输出、查找、插入、删除、及释放操作 1 #include<stdio.h> 2 #include<stdlib.h> 3 //建立动态单向链表,结点类型; 4 typedef struct student{ 5 int no; 6 int score; 7 struct student *next; 8 }; 9 //创建一个链表 10 struct student *head; 11 struct student *creat() 12 { 13 struct student *p,*q; 14 int n, i; 15 printf(&quo 阅读全文
posted @ 2011-05-22 00:15 左手心_疼 阅读(369) 评论(1) 推荐(1) 编辑
摘要: 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||——————————————————————————————链表————————————————————————————------------------____________________________________________________________________________________________ 阅读全文
posted @ 2011-05-19 00:15 左手心_疼 阅读(1433) 评论(1) 推荐(1) 编辑
摘要: 本人有点关于数据结构的几个问题:请大家指教::: 栈(听说是最好写的一个程序)不过还是错误百出!!!一开始写栈时,错误老多,改了好几次终于改好了,不过还是有点不懂的地方: 一个栈的程序 《1》《2》《3》处不懂 程序中已表明 程序代码如下: 1 #include<stdio.h> 2 #include<stdlib.h> 3 #define SIZE 5 4 5 typedef struct { 6 int data[SIZE]; 7 int top; 8 }snode; 9 snode *s; 10 11 void initstack(snode *&s)// 阅读全文
posted @ 2011-05-16 18:11 左手心_疼 阅读(545) 评论(4) 推荐(1) 编辑